Ist bei der MySQL-Datenbank die Groß-/Kleinschreibung beachtet? Benötigen Sie spezifische Codebeispiele
Bei der Verwendung der MySQL-Datenbank treten manchmal Probleme mit der Groß-/Kleinschreibung auf, d. h. beim Abfragen, Einfügen oder Aktualisieren von Daten können unterschiedliche Groß-/Kleinschreibungssituationen zu unterschiedlichen Ergebnissen führen. Die MySQL-Datenbank weist eine gewisse Sensibilität im Umgang mit Groß- und Kleinschreibung auf. Lassen Sie uns anhand konkreter Codebeispiele die Sensibilität der MySQL-Datenbank gegenüber Groß- und Kleinschreibung genauer untersuchen.
Erstellen wir zunächst eine einfache Datenbanktabelle zur Beispieldemonstration:
CREATE TABLE users ( id INT PRIMARY KEY, username VARCHAR(50) ); INSERT INTO users (id, username) VALUES (1, 'JohnDoe'); INSERT INTO users (id, username) VALUES (2, 'janedoe');
Der obige Code erstellt eine Tabelle mit dem Namen users
, die id
und username</ enthält. Code> zwei Felder und zwei Datensätze werden eingefügt. Unter anderem speichert das Feld <code>username
Benutzernamen in verschiedenen Fällen. users
的表格,包含了id
和username
两个字段,并插入了两条记录。其中,username
字段存储了不同大小写的用户名。
接下来,我们通过代码示例来观察MySQL数据库在不同情况下对大小写的处理:
SELECT * FROM users WHERE username = 'JohnDoe';
上述查询语句中,username
使用了大小写混合的形式。MySQL数据库会对大小写进行敏感匹配,只有当大小写完全一致时才会返回结果。
INSERT INTO users (id, username) VALUES (3, 'johndoe');
在插入操作中,MySQL数据库同样会对大小写进行敏感性检查。虽然johndoe
与JohnDoe
看似相似,但由于大小写不同,数据库会将其作为不同的记录插入。
UPDATE users SET username = 'JaneDoe' WHERE id = 2;
在更新操作中,对大小写的敏感性同样适用。即使janedoe
johndoe
und JohnDoe
ähnlich aussehen, werden sie aufgrund ihrer unterschiedlichen Groß- und Kleinschreibung von der Datenbank als unterschiedliche Datensätze eingefügt. 🎜janedoe
ein vorhandener Datensatz ist, wird der Aktualisierungsvorgang aufgrund der Nichtübereinstimmung der Groß- und Kleinschreibung ausgeführt und nicht als doppelte Daten behandelt. 🎜🎜Zusammenfassend lässt sich sagen, dass in der MySQL-Datenbank die Groß-/Kleinschreibung beachtet wird und es notwendig ist, die Groß-/Kleinschreibung im Vorgang genau abzugleichen, um die richtigen Ergebnisse zu erhalten. Achten Sie beim Schreiben von Code unbedingt auf die Konsistenz der Groß- und Kleinschreibung, um Probleme durch Groß- und Kleinschreibung zu vermeiden. 🎜🎜Durch die obigen Codebeispiele hoffe ich, dass die Leser ein tieferes Verständnis für das Verhalten der MySQL-Datenbank bei der Verarbeitung von Groß- und Kleinschreibung erlangen können, um Datenbankoperationen genauer ausführen zu können. 🎜Das obige ist der detaillierte Inhalt vonIst bei MySQL-Datenbanken die Groß-/Kleinschreibung beachtet?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!